I was born & raised in the Yakima Valley & graduated from AC Davis High School in 1970. I went on to Oral Robert University & transferred to the University of Tulsa where I graduated with a Bachelor’s Degree in Sociology/Psychology. After returning to Yakima in 1975, I met & married my husband, Stephen. We moved to the Aberdeen area where we had our children, Jacob & Sarah.

During that time, I was a county coordinator for social services & then was hired to be the executive director of a non-profit organization in 1977, Timberland Opportunities. Timberland provided training, employment & Placement services to developmentally disabled adults.

We moved to Marysville in 1989, when Stephen was hired by the Snohomish School District & eventually became an Executive Director to the Superintendent, in charge of Special Services. He retired from that job in 2004 & is now a Senior Faculty Advisor with City-University.

Our children, Jacob & Sarah, both graduated from Marysville-Pilchuck High School. Jacob works for me & is pursuing his own business. Sarah, after playing basketball & attending North N. Seattle Community College, is taking a break from college, assisting the Basketball Program at M-PHS and working.

Steve and I have volunteered for years in our community including Marysville Little League, Youth Soccer, AAU Basketball, Marysville Booster Club, Windermere Community Service, & more. We believe in supporting our Community.
